Our facility is licensed by the California Department of Social Services (CDSS), Community Care Licensing Division. The CDSS requires our staff to go through multiple screening processes before obtaining employment to work with seniors in our facility. Our professional staff is composed of qualified and carefully selected individuals who exhibit a compassionate and gentle demeanor with our seniors. Our caregivers have extensive initial training before working with clients face-to-face to ensure a thorough understanding of the important work they are doing. Our caregivers also receive comprehensive hands-on training in working with the residents. After being hired, our caregivers are required to complete several hours of training on an annual basis. Some of the topics for training include:

  • Personal Care Services
  • Physical Limitations and needs of the elderly
  • Psychosocial needs of the elderly
  • Residents’ Rights
  • Policies and Procedures regarding medication
  • Cultural Competency
  • Dementia Care
  • Building safety, responding to emergencies
  • Postural supports
  • Restricted health conditions
  • Hospice Care
  • First Aid
  • Elder Abuse
  • Medication Training

Frequently Asked Questions

How are caregivers screened before working with the facility?
We follow California licensing guidelines that require fingerprinting, background checks, and clearance through the Department of Justice before caregivers are approved to work with residents.
What kind of training do staff members complete before working with residents?
We provide training that covers elderly care, residents’ rights, safety procedures, dementia support, and personal care skills to prepare caregivers for direct care responsibilities.
How often do caregivers receive additional training after being hired?
Our caregivers complete annual training hours on topics such as emergency response, elder abuse awareness, and medication handling to maintain compliance and quality of care.
Are staff trained to support residents with memory conditions?
Yes, we include dementia-specific training as part of our required education so that our caregivers understand how to assist with communication, behavior changes, and safety needs.
Who supervises the caregivers during their shifts?
We have administrators and designated supervisors on-site who oversee staff performance, address concerns, and ensure that care is consistent with state requirements.
